Output c81197642d6bf4c13d86aaa22004ff413712774a5b164013802658d141ef2460:1

value
27306366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ad27ee452b36889a3a84d80424bc526a35c734f OP_EQUAL
address
3BRqiNcUei2MSmSqAyzko7GzSysf9ytLoq
transaction
c81197642d6bf4c13d86aaa22004ff413712774a5b164013802658d141ef2460
confirmations
301633
spent
true